Method 2:
\Write the prime factorization of each number.
\224 = 2 × 2 × 2 × 2 × 2 × 7.
\243 = 3 × 3 × 3 × 3 × 3.
\There are no common prime factors.Two numbers always have 1 as a common factor.
\So, the GCF is 1, and the numbers are relativety prime.
